Orthopedic surgeons operating in Bangkok's advanced medical facilities regularly perform high-precision osteotomies, total hip arthroplasties (THA), total knee arthroplasties (TKA), and spinal decompression surgeries. These procedures require bone drills and sagittal saws that minimize thermal necrosis risk. Thermal necrosis occurs when bone tissue is exposed to temperatures above 47°C for extended periods. Our medical power tools mitigate this risk through integrated high-torque, brushless DC motors that maintain stable rotational speeds under heavy loads, ensuring clean, rapid cuts and reducing bone thermal injury.

Surgical instruments are exposed to harsh environments, particularly high temperatures and chemical cleaners during reprocessing. Our large bone drills and saws are manufactured using high-grade 316L medical stainless steel and anodized aluminum alloys. Crucial electronic components are encased in high-temperature resistant PEEK (Polyether ether ketone) protective shells to prevent fluid entry.
Our handpieces are designed to withstand autoclaving temperatures up to 135°C (275°F) and 2.2 bar pressure, conforming strictly to international hospital reprocessing requirements. The seals are rated to IPX8 liquid ingress protection, shielding internal components from moisture, saline, and biological fluids during operation and cleaning.

| Tool Type | No-Load Speed Range | Max Torque Performance | Sterilization Compatibility | Key Applications |
|---|---|---|---|---|
| Large Bone Drill | 0 – 1200 rpm (variable) | ≥ 4.5 N.m | Autoclave 135°C / Gas Plasma | Joint replacement, Trauma fixation |
| Cannulated Drill | 0 – 1000 rpm (variable) | ≥ 5.0 N.m | Autoclave 135°C / Gas Plasma | Intramedullary nailing, K-wire insertion |
| Sagittal Saw | 0 – 15000 osc/min | High displacement torque | Autoclave 135°C / Gas Plasma | Osteotomies, Joint arthroplasty |
| Cranial Bur/Drill | 0 – 40000 rpm (variable) | Balanced high-speed torque | Autoclave 135°C / Gas Plasma | Neurosurgery, Cranial access |

Navigating the regulatory framework of the Thailand Food and Drug Administration (TFDA) is vital for importing and using medical devices. We support Bangkok distributors by providing full technical documentation, including ISO 13485 certification, IEC 60601-1 electrical safety reports, and biocompatibility documentation.
Additionally, we work closely with local representatives to streamline registration under Class II/III medical devices. Our compliance processes align with the ASEAN Medical Device Directive (AMDD), simplifying cross-border custom clearances and verifying the safety of our medical devices for hospital environments.
